High-resolution powder diffraction study of purple membrane with a large Guinier-type camera.
Explore this paper's citation graph
Summary
A combination of synchrotron X-rays and large Guinier camera can be used for analyzing the conformational changes of bacteriorhodopsin (BR) trimers in the intact state and the method might be extended to the structural analysis of film materials composed of two-dimensional arrays of nanoparticles.
